Dudley. Humphrey DeForest Bogart
(December 25, 1899 January 14, 1957) was an
iconic American actor of legendary fame who
retained his legacy after death. Thomas Lanier Williams III
(March 26, 1911 February 25, 1983), better
known by the pseudonym Tennessee Williams, was a
major American playwright and one of the prominent
playwrights of the twentieth century. Oliver Wendell Holmes Sr.,
(August 29, 1809 October 7, 1894) was a
physician by profession but achieved fame as a
writer; he was one of the best regarded American
poets of the 19th century. John Arthur Lithgow (IPA:
['??n 'l???.go]) (born October 19, 1945) is
an American actor perhaps best-known for his
starring role as Dick Solomon in the NBC sitcom 3rd
Rock from the Sun. Allen Kelsey Grammer (born
February 21, 1955) is a five-time Emmy and Golden
Globe-winning American actor who is best known for
his two decade portrayal of psychiatrist Dr.
Frasier Crane in the NBC sitcoms Cheers and
Frasier. Christopher Reeve (September
25, 1952 October 10, 2004) was an American
actor, director, producer and writer. James Abram Garfield
(November 19, 1831 September 19, 1881) was
the 20th President of the United States (1881) and
the second U.S. President to be assassinated
(Abraham Lincoln was the first). John Forbes Kerry (born
December 11, 1943) is the junior United States
Senator from Massachusetts, in his fourth term of
office. Herbert Clark Hoover, (August
10, 1874 October 20, 1964), the 31st
President of the United States (19291933),
was a world-famous mining engineer and humanitarian
administrator. William Ellery (December 22,
1727February 15, 1820), was a signer of the
United States Declaration of Independence as a
representative of Rhode Island. Brigham Young (June 1, 1801
August 29, 1877) was the second prophet and
president of The Church of Jesus Christ of
Latter-day Saints. He was also the first governor
of the Utah Territory. David Hackett Souter (born
September 17, 1939) has been an Associate Justice
of the Supreme Court of the United States since
1990.
